项目概况
PROJECTOVERVIEW
E3图书馆档案馆位于华南理工大学广州国际校区南北主轴线南侧,正对校园仪式性广场和校园主入口,以滨河景观带为界,形成和E5学生活动中心的对望关系,东西侧紧邻公共教学楼和公共实验楼。
The E3 Library and Archives is located on the south side of the north-south main axis of Guangzhou International Campus, South China University of Technology. It faces the ceremonial square and main entrance of the campus. With the riverside landscape belt serving as a boundary, this positioning establishes a visual relationship with the E5 Cultural Activity Center opposite. In addition, its eastern and western sides are closely adjacent to the public teaching building and the public laboratory building, respectively.

设计理念
DESIGN CONCEPT
设计之初对于建筑与空间的设想主要有以下几个出发点:如何打造在新时代教学科研模式创新和信息化时代知识传播获取模式变革的双层语境下的高校图书馆空间模式;如何构建“双碳”目标下具备气候适应性的绿色低碳校园建筑;如何全面整合建筑空间与结构形式,兼顾建构逻辑、经济美观;如何结合BIM正向设计模式,合理完成各专业之间的整合设计。基于以上考量,图书馆档案馆以“知识之冠、书山智谷”为设计理念,立足于岭南地域的现代化叙事,建立气候适应性的绿色建筑与空间原型,构筑人、文化、空间与自然的静谧关联。

知识之冠 书山智谷
CROWN OF KNOWLEDGE, VALLEY OF WISDOM IN THE BOOK MOUNTAIN
为满足图书馆与档案馆一体两用的功能需求,方案以覆土基座为档案藏储,抬升主体为开放阅览的功能组织策略展开设计。通过自下向上外挑倾斜的整体造型策略,构建气候自适应的基础形体。北向形体考虑光照条件则优化为自下向上内倾状态,增加北向采光量,同时减少对滨水绿岸的压迫感,与河道对岸的E5学生活动中心产生互动对话。形体设计保证了建筑整体空间的热舒适度,满足了阅览光照的需求,是新岭南建筑适候设计美学的具体表现。
To meet the dual functional requirements of integrating a library and an archive, the design adopts a strategic approach by embedding the archival storage within a vegetated earth-sheltered base and elevating the main structure above to accommodate open reading spaces. The overall form is shaped through an upward-cantilevering, sloping strategy that establishes a climate-responsive foundation. On the northern elevation, the form is refined to tilt inward from base to top, maximizing northern light exposure while alleviating visual pressure on the riverside greenbelt, thereby engaging in a dynamic dialogue with the E5 Cultural Activity Center on the opposite bank. This architectural design ensures thermal comfort throughout the interior spaces and meets reading-area lighting needs, reflecting the climate-responsive design aesthetics of New Lingnan architecture.

设计将图书馆功能与“山”、“谷”空间原型结合转译,建立“书山智谷”主体空间模式。图书馆内部以南北贯通的中庭设计,打造校园中轴线视觉通廊,将方正平面一分为二,建立前后景观的对话关系。建筑中部为开放“智谷”空间,集合社交、休闲、展览等公共服务功能;两侧为致密“书山”空间,综合阅读、研究、收藏等信息媒介功能。作为高校教育发展的重要基础设施,我们希望图书馆作为校园共享物质空间核心的同时,更应该是承载校园文化的精神中心。“书山智谷”空间既利于高效满足基本空间需求,又利于创造最大化的空间丰富性与开放性。

The design integrates library functions with the spatial archetypes of “mountain” and “valley,” transforming them into the core spatial concept of “Book Mountain and Wisdom Valley.” Internally, a north-south atrium creates a visual corridor along the campus central axis, dividing the rectangular layout into two halves and establishing a dialogue between the front and rear landscapes. At the heart of the building lies the open “Wisdom Valley,” accommodating social, leisure, exhibition, and other public service functions, while the two sides form the dense “Book Mountain,” accommodating reading, research, archival storage, and other information-related functions. As a critical infrastructure for the university’s educational development, the library is envisioned not only as a central shared physical space on campus but also as a spiritual hub embodying campus culture. The “Book Mountain and Wisdom Valley” concept efficiently meets basic spatial needs while maximizing spatial richness and openness.

虚实对比 一体建构
INTEGRATED CONSTRUCTION THROUGH CONTRAST OF VOID AND SOLID
基于气候自适应形体,立面设计以斜向格栅表皮系统回应空间结构与功能需求。砖红色条状蜂窝铝板与玻璃幕墙嵌套结合组成斜向格栅表皮系统,格栅内部与主体梁板共建一体化自承重体系来应对形体倾斜带来的结构挑战。斜向格栅表皮系统兼具结构与遮阳功能,简约灵动,如同一本打开的书,面向校园空间。
The facade design addresses spatial structure and functional requirements through an inclined grid cladding system. Composed of brick-red strip-shaped aluminum honeycomb panels nested within glass curtain walls, the grid integrates with the main beams and slabs to form a unified self-supporting system, effectively addressing the structural challenges posed by the building’s sloping form. The facade combines structural and sun shading functions, embodying a simple yet dynamic aesthetic akin to an open book facing the campus space.

除南北贯通中庭外,图书馆在东西两侧中部设置了以交通功能为主的边厅漫游场所,与南北贯通中庭共同组成出类“十”字型交叉状的空间体系。“十”字型空间外化转译为立面玻璃“窗口”空间,和周边建筑形成紧密对话,并分别朝向最佳景观,在营造丰富体验的同时,也面向校园展现图书馆内部活动空间图景。
In addition to the north-south atrium, the building incorporates side halls on the eastern and western facades, primarily serving circulation functions, which together with the north-south atrium form a distinctive cross-shaped spatial system. This cross-shaped spatial layout is externally expressed as glazed “window” openings on the facade, establishing a close dialogue with the surrounding architecture. Oriented toward optimal views, these openings not only create a rich experiential quality but also offer glimpses into the library’s internal activity spaces from across the campus.

多元体验 场所关联
ASSOCIATION WITH DIVERSE EXPERIENCE VENUES
出于照明控制、运输通道、安保要求、绿色建筑标准等多维考量,我们将档案馆和其技术用房布置于建筑首层基座部分,与之对应的图书馆库房和其技术用房也布置于此。为更好的向校园生活开放与共享,在此还设置了国际报告厅、多功能厅和展厅等功能,建筑二层和二层以上则为图书馆主体功能。其中,二层为阅览室、自习室、咖啡厅、门厅和其他辅助功能;三层四层为开架阅览区,加以局部电子阅览区、特藏馆等;五层为功能各异的“小盒子”,包含研讨室、会议室、图书馆行政用房区、高科技体验区等丰富且灵活的空间。
To comprehensively address factors such as lighting control, transport access, security requirements, and green building standards, the archives are positioned within the building’s ground-level base section, where the library’s storage rooms and technical facilities are also located. To foster greater openness, the ground floor also houses an international lecture hall, multi-purpose halls, exhibition spaces, and related functions. The primary library functions are situated on the second floor and above. The second floor accommodates reading rooms, study areas, a café, a lobby, and auxiliary facilities. The third and fourth floors are dedicated to open-shelf reading areas, complemented by shared functions such as electronic reading zones and special collections. The fifth floor features ‘small-box’ spaces, primarily serving as seminar rooms, meeting rooms, library administrative offices, and high-tech experience zones.

在这个5.2万平方米的开放、互联空间中,知识的传递与分享以多样形式自然展开。图书馆以“书山智谷”共享中庭为核心,通过“方”与“圆”交通枢纽、不同尺度的边庭以及嵌入式院落空间,构筑出层次丰富的共享体验: 书香氤然,宁静致远,创造了师生日常生活中的漫游或停顿体验。空间如一场持续被发现的旅程,在往复之间深化归属感与场所的复杂意蕴,最终成为一个融合个人记忆与集体记忆的建筑设计。
In this 52,000-square-meter open and interconnected space, the transmission and sharing of knowledge unfold naturally in diverse forms. Centered around the shared atrium of the “Book Mountain and Wisdom Valley,” the library employs square and circular circulation hubs, side halls of varying scales, and embedded courtyard spaces to create a richly shared experience. Immersed in the serene atmosphere of scholarly tranquility, the building fosters moments of wandering or pause in the daily lives of teachers and students. The space unfolds like an ongoing journey of discovery, deepening a sense of belonging and the complex meaning of place through repeated engagement. Ultimately, it becomes an architectural design that intertwines personal memory with collective memory.

绿色建筑:主被动技术协同 探索低碳校园建筑
SYNERGY OF ACTIVE AND PASSIVE STRATEGIES FOR LOW-CARBON CAMPUS ARCHITECTURE
设计积极探索绿色低碳的发展模式,以被动式设计策略为主导,打造了主被动技术协同的示范性低碳校园建筑。通过对建筑设计自身的优化完善,形成基于地域气候的自适应设计特色建筑与空间。项目重点表达:基于自遮阳内聚式体型模型,构建绿色低碳节能的适应性建筑形体;通过可呼吸式性能化围护界面设计,优化室内的风光热环境;采用低能耗的空间形态和组织方式,围绕共享中庭形成呼吸腔,动态调节空间舒适度;响应碳中和目标,建立校园产能示范平台,在建筑屋顶布置光伏发电装置提供有效的能源供给;结合首层种植地面、绿化天井、屋顶花园等设计,降低辐射与热岛强度,并作为生物滞留,设置雨水收集装置可用于景观植物灌溉。

The design actively explores a green and low-carbon development model, prioritizing passive design strategies while integrating active technologies to create a campus architecture demonstration of carbon reduction. Key design expressions include: Based on a self-shading form model, an adaptive architectural shape that prioritizes green, low-carbon, and energy-efficient principles is constructed. Through the design of high-performance building envelope, the indoor environment is optimized for wind, light, and thermal comfort. Adopting low-energy consumption spatial forms and organizational methods, a breathing cavity is formed around the shared atrium to dynamically adjust the spatial comfort. In response to the carbon neutrality goal, and to establish a campus energy production demonstration platform, photovoltaic power generation devices are installed on the rooftops of buildings to provide effective energy supply. Integrating features such as planted ground areas, green courtyards, and roof gardens, the design reduces solar radiation and mitigates the heat island effect. Additionally, rainwater collection systems are implemented to support the irrigation of landscape plants.

结语
COMPREHENSIVE BENEFIT
作为校园空间体系中的标志性节点,E3图书馆档案馆坐落于生活区与教学区的结构性交界处,承担着空间转换与行为引导的枢纽职能。其设计理念、空间建构与场地环境、功能需求紧密结合,建筑强调空间与体量之间的严谨章法,着重材料属性与建构逻辑的地域表达。项目以“知识之冠、书山智谷”为设计出发点,着力构建人、文化、空间与自然之间的静谧关联,塑造具有精神属性的校园核心场所。
As a landmark node within the campus spatial system, the E3 Library and Archives is situated at the structural intersection between the residential and academic zones, serving as a pivotal hub for spatial transition and behavioral guidance. Its design philosophy and spatial construction are closely integrated with the site context and functional requirements, emphasizing a rigorous interplay between space and volume while highlighting the regional expression of material properties and tectonic logic. With the design concept of “Knowledge Crown, Wisdom Valley in the Book Mountain,” the project strives to establish a serene connection among people, culture, space, and nature.

项目名称:华南理工大学广州国际校区二期工程-E3地块图书馆档案馆
项目类型:教育建筑
项目地址:广州市番禺区
建筑面积:52338㎡
设计时间:2020.07-2020.12
竣工时间:2022.12
设计单位:华南理工大学建筑设计研究院有限公司
业主单位:华南理工大学
建设单位:广州越秀城开房地产开发有限公司
施工单位:中国建筑第五工程局有限公司
获奖情况:2023年度广东省优秀工程勘察设计奖公共建筑设计一等奖;2022年至2026年度中国建筑学会科普教育基地(绿色低碳科普基地);2022~2023年度中国建设工程鲁班奖(国家优质工程)
